WebThe APHAB produces scores for 4 subscales: Ease of Communication (EC), Reverberation (RV), Background Noise (BN), and Aversiveness (AV) To administer and interpret the APHAB, you will need the APHAB questionnaire and a method for scoring …

WebAbbreviated Profile of Hearing Aid Benefit (APHAB) Description Self-reported tool that measures the amount of trouble they are having with communication or noises in various everyday situations Targeted Age Adults Items (Domains) 24 (4) Estimated Completion Time 5 – 10 minutes Reliability/Validity Assessment Yes/Yes Literature

The APHAB questionnaire is an abbreviated version of the Profile of Hearing Aid Benefit, which was originally designed to measure the benefit a patient gains from using a hearing aid. The APHAB comprises 24 items that are scored in 4 subscales. The subscales are as follows.
